简介:许多朋友问有关Django如何使用HTML显示图片的问题。首席执行官在本文中注明将为您提供详细的答案,以供所有人参考。我希望这对每个人都会有所帮助!让我们一起看看!
如果您也处于这种情况下,可以通过以下方案解决90%的问题,
在浏览器中打开Django随附的背景管理员,发现浏览器成功的响应是成功的,但是丢失了样式。
不用担心,Winl+R(Win Key是键盘左下角的第二个键)打开输入regedit以打开您的注册表,
然后找到hkey_classses_root -.css(前面有一个点...)然后单击它,然后选择内容类型
文本/CSS内容更改的初始内容是应用程序/X-CSS,因此丢失了样式。更改后
刷新浏览器+重新启动Django服务器,您想要的样式将恢复,
您可以将其转移给您的专业测试
需要在URL中配置它
urlpatterns =模式('',,
#第一个参数是显示图片的URL
#Django的静态模块
#第三文件的实际路径
url(r'^static/(?ppath。*)','django.views.static.serve',{'document_root':'d:/wwwsite/office/office/static'})
治愈
然后在相应的HTML文件中
img src =“/static/images/psb.jpg”
应该没事的
似乎有一个问题。
将图片文件(例如JPG)放在应用程序名称文件夹下方的静态文件夹下(前提是您的CSS,JS和其他文件可以正常访问)。
那么您可以这样访问它
一点,您需要出去,回来处理...
在Django背景中添加HTML编辑器的方法:
1.下载友善者
下载固定器,在解压缩后,应删除并复制到静态目录的无用ASP,ASP.NET,PHP,JSP,示例文件。由于Kindeditor是JS文件中的编辑器,因此设置了JS/Editor目录。复制固定器代码到目录。就像此statation/js/js/editor/chinditor-4.1.7一样。
2.在文本输入域的HTML中添加与相应网站相对应的Javarscript。
3.在HTML页面上添加以下脚本:
4.创建chindeditor并在indededitor-4.1.7目录中创建配置。
//config.js
hindeditor.ready(function(k){
window.editor = k.create('#id_content',{
// 指定
宽度:“ 800px”,
身高:“ 200px”,
});
});
#admin.py
来自django.contrib导入管理
从chindeditor.models导入文章
#在这里注册您的模型。
@admin.register(文章)
类articleadmin(admin.modeladmin):
list_display =('title',)
班级媒体:
#在管理背景中的HTML文件中添加JS文件,每个路径都会添加static_url/
js =((
'js/editor/hindeditor-4.1.7/hindeditor- all.js',
'js/editor/hindeditor-4.1.7/lang.zh_cn.js',
'js/editor/hindeditor-4.1.7/config.js',
治愈
结论:以上是主要CTO的全部内容,请注意Django如何使用HTML显示图片。感谢您阅读本网站的内容。我希望这对您有帮助。有关Django如何使用HTML显示相关图片的更多信息,请不要忘记在此站点上找到它。